#d43ca2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d43ca2 is composed of 83.1% red, 23.5%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 319.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 53.3%. #d43ca2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78ff with #a90045.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#d43ca2 color description : Moderate pink.
#d43ca2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d43ca2 has RGB values of R:212, G:60,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.24,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13909154.

Shades and Tints of #d43ca2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e030a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d43ca2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8589 is the less saturated color, while #f917af is the most saturated one.
